A member asked:

Today i had dental work done and the gums near my tooth r sore and irritated. i feel pain radiating in teeth on that side. can that also be from gums?

Yes: It's not uncommon to have some soreness after dental treatment. Obviously it depends upon what the actual treatment was. It should get better within a couple of days. It is always best to speak to the dentist who actually performed the treatment concerning what to expect and for how long afterwards.

Very common: The pain is noticed immediately after the anesthesia wears off and continues up to 72 hours. Take NSAID OTC or Tylenol (acetaminophen) for pain control. If concerned, see your dentist for post-op examination.
